NASSAU EDUCATORS FEDERAL CREDIT UNION BREAKS GROUND ON NEW MAIN OFFICE FACILITY
Premier Roosevelt Raceway Location Provides Improved Access and Added Convenience for Members

JUNE 4, 2001 - VALLEY STREAM, NY, ATLANTA, GA - Nassau Educators Federal Credit Union, Valley Stream, New York, today announced that it has begun development of a new, state-of-the-art main office facility. The three-story, 50,000 square foot building, scheduled for completion in the fall of 2002, will become the organization's new main office and fifth branch.

The new building will be located at the site of the former Roosevelt Raceway and situated in Nassau County's premier retail and commercial development. The facility will be double the size of Nassau Educators' current main office and is reflective of the extensive growth the credit union has experienced in recent years. The new, centralized location will provide added convenience for and offer a multitude of services to its members. The facility will house member services, executive and administrative offices, call center operations, human resources and employee training facilities.

About Nassau Educators Federal Credit Union
Nassau Educators Federal Credit Union operates branches in Valley Stream, Syosset and Brookville, and will be opening its newest branch in Massapequa this summer. The credit union serves over 76,000 members primarily from the field of education and is committed to the members and communities it serves. For more information, visit www.nassaued.org.
